Transaction 1791aa000680a524d343894de741cdb3252f7e9ea7720ac8b43c110cd9c85b12
1 Input
1 Output
-
1791aa000680a524d343894de741cdb3252f7e9ea7720ac8b43c110cd9c85b12:0
- value
- 114081
- script pubkey
- OP_0 OP_PUSHBYTES_20 620df9ae90193f7ca2cef9deb6a2e4555a454ffe
- address
- bc1qvgxlnt5srylhegkwl80tdghy24dy2nl7v5jzq6